Panorama Me in front of Cirauqui - Rough translation 'Nest of vipers' Daily life on the Camino is simple. Walk, find a bed, food, water and a bar. I'll break the day down further so that you can understand the minor details. Albergues or Refuges have daily hours of opening around 14:00 for check in.
